A full-term neonate develops severe unconjugated hyperbilirubinaemia of 22 mg/dL on day 2 despite a negative Coombs test, no evidence of haemolysis, and a completely normal examination. An older sibling had required exchange transfusion for early jaundice. Maternal serum inhibits UDP-glucuronosyltransferase activity when tested in vitro. Which condition is described?

  • A Crigler-Najjar syndrome type II
  • B Dubin-Johnson syndrome
  • C Gilbert syndrome
  • D Lucey-Driscoll syndrome
Correct answer: D. Lucey-Driscoll syndrome

Explanation

Lucey-Driscoll syndrome, or transient familial neonatal hyperbilirubinaemia, results from an unidentified inhibitor of UDP-glucuronosyltransferase present in maternal serum that crosses the placenta. It produces marked unconjugated jaundice in the first 48 hours, often recurs in siblings, and carries a real kernicterus risk requiring intensive phototherapy or exchange transfusion. It resolves spontaneously within the first few weeks. Crigler-Najjar is a permanent genetic enzyme defect, not a transient maternal factor mediated disorder.
